- Java.lang 包類
- Java.lang - 首頁
- Java.lang - Boolean
- Java.lang - Byte
- Java.lang - Character
- Java.lang - Character.Subset
- Java.lang - Character.UnicodeBlock
- Java.lang - Class
- Java.lang - ClassLoader
- Java.lang - Compiler
- Java.lang - Double
- Java.lang - Enum
- Java.lang - Float
- Java.lang - InheritableThreadLocal
- Java.lang - Integer
- Java.lang - Long
- Java.lang - Math
- Java.lang - Number
- Java.lang - Object
- Java.lang - Package
- Java.lang - Process
- Java.lang - ProcessBuilder
- Java.lang - Runtime
- Java.lang - RuntimePermission
- Java.lang - SecurityManager
- Java.lang - Short
- Java.lang - StackTraceElement
- Java.lang - StrictMath
- Java.lang - String
- Java.lang - StringBuffer
- Java.lang - StringBuilder
- Java.lang - System
- Java.lang - Thread
- Java.lang - ThreadGroup
- Java.lang - ThreadLocal
- Java.lang - Throwable
- Java.lang - Void
- Java.lang 包補充
- Java.lang - 介面
- Java.lang - 錯誤
- Java.lang - 異常
- Java.lang 包有用資源
- Java.lang - 有用資源
- Java.lang - 討論
Java - Double byteValue() 方法
描述
Java Double byteValue() 方法將此 Double 值作為位元組返回(透過強制轉換為位元組)。
宣告
以下是 java.lang.Double.byteValue() 方法的宣告
public byte byteValue()
引數
無
返回值
此方法返回此物件表示的 double 值,轉換為 byte 型別。
異常
無
使用 new 運算子建立的 Double 物件獲取位元組示例
以下示例演示了使用 new 運算子建立的 Double 物件的 Double byteValue() 方法的使用。我們建立一個 Double 變數,併為其賦值一個使用 new 運算子建立的 Double 物件。然後建立一個位元組變數,並使用 byteValue() 方法為其賦值一個位元組值,然後列印結果。
package com.tutorialspoint;
public class DoubleDemo {
public static void main(String[] args) {
// create a Double object d
Double d;
// assign value to d
d = new Double("100");
// create a byte primitive bt
byte bt;
// assign primitive value of d to bt
bt = d.byteValue();
String str = "Primitive byte value of Double object " + d + " is " + bt;
// print bt value
System.out.println( str );
}
}
輸出
讓我們編譯並執行上述程式,這將產生以下結果:
Primitive byte value of Double object 100.0 is 100
使用 valueOf(String) 方法建立的 Double 物件獲取位元組示例
以下示例演示了使用 valueOf(String) 方法建立的 Double 物件的 Double byteValue() 方法的使用。我們建立一個 Double 變數,併為其賦值一個使用 valueOf(String) 方法建立的 Double 物件。然後建立一個位元組變數,並使用 byteValue() 方法為其賦值一個位元組值,然後列印結果。
package com.tutorialspoint;
public class DoubleDemo {
public static void main(String[] args) {
// create a Double object d
Double d;
// assign value to d
d = Double.valueOf("100");
// create a byte primitive bt
byte bt;
// assign primitive value of d to bt
bt = d.byteValue();
String str = "Primitive byte value of Double object " + d + " is " + bt;
// print bt value
System.out.println( str );
}
}
輸出
讓我們編譯並執行上述程式,這將產生以下結果:
Primitive byte value of Double object 100.0 is 100
使用 valueOf(byte) 方法建立的 Double 物件獲取位元組示例
以下示例演示了使用 valueOf(byte) 方法建立的 Double 物件的 Double byteValue() 方法的使用。我們建立一個 Double 變數,併為其賦值一個使用 valueOf(byte) 方法建立的 Double 物件。然後建立一個位元組變數,並使用 byteValue() 方法為其賦值一個位元組值,然後列印結果。
package com.tutorialspoint;
public class DoubleDemo {
public static void main(String[] args) {
// create a Double object d
Double d;
// assign value to d
d = Double.valueOf((byte) 100);
// create a byte primitive bt
byte bt;
// assign primitive value of d to bt
bt = d.byteValue();
String str = "Primitive byte value of Double object " + d + " is " + bt;
// print bt value
System.out.println( str );
}
}
輸出
讓我們編譯並執行上述程式,這將產生以下結果:
Primitive byte value of Double object 100.0 is 100
java_lang_double.htm
廣告